Russia has a long history of top-quality academic research and teaching. More and more students are drawn to this exciting country every year.
The preeminent institution is Lomonosov Moscow State University (MSU), firmly ranked among the 100 best universities in the world. There are also many technical universities and engineering schools in Russia that enjoy a global reputation in their disciplines.
And expect more Russian universities to keep climbing the international rankings: “Project 5-100”, an official government initiative, aims at pushing at least five institutions into the world’s top 100.
University | QS Ranking 2023 | THE Ranking 2022 | ARWU Ranking 2022 |
---|---|---|---|
Lomonosov Moscow State University (MSU) | 75 | 158 | 101 |
Bauman Moscow State Technical University | 230 | 801 | – |
Novosibirsk State University | 260 | 801 | 701 |
Tomsk State University | 264 | 601 | 701 |
Moscow Institute of Physics and Technology (MIPT) | 267 | 201 | 501 |
St Petersburg University | 270 | 601 | 301 |
Peoples' Friendship University of Russia | 295 | 601 | – |
National Research Nuclear University MEPhI (Moscow Engineering Physics Institute) | 308 | 401 | 801 |
Higher School of Economics (HSE) | 308 | 301 | 601 |
Kazan Federal University | 322 | 801 | – |
Ural Federal University | 335 | 1001 | 701 |
MGIMO University | 345 | – | – |
ITMO University | 359 | 601 | – |
Peter the Great St. Petersburg Polytechnic University | 382 | 301 | – |
Tomsk Polytechnic University | 398 | 801 | – |
Far Eastern Federal University (FEFU) | 434 | 1201 | – |
National University of Science and Technology MISiS | 467 | 601 | – |
Altai State University | 521 | – | – |
Southern Federal University | 541 | 1201 | – |
Saratov State University | 551 | 1201 | – |
Samara University | 601 | 1201 | – |
Immanuel Kant Baltic Federal University | 601 | 1201 | – |
Plekhanov Russian University of Economics | 651 | 501 | – |
Sechenov University | 651 | 1001 | 601 |
Saint Petersburg Electrotechnical University "LETI" | 751 | 1201 | – |
Lobachevsky University | 751 | 1201 | – |
University of Tyumen | 801 | 1201 | – |
Ufa State Aviation Technical University | 801 | 1201 | – |
Russian Presidential Academy of National Economy and Public Administration (RANEPA) | 801 | 1201 | – |
Perm State University | 801 | 1201 | – |
Novosibirsk State Technical University | 801 | 1201 | – |
Saint-Petersburg Mining University | 801 | 401 | – |
South Ural State University | 801 | 1001 | – |
Voronezh State University | 1001 | 1201 | – |
Kazan National Research Technological University | 1001 | 1201 | – |
Belgorod State National Research University | 1001 | 1201 | – |
Siberian Federal University | 1001 | 1001 | – |
Mendeleev University of Chemical Technology | 1001 | – | – |
Herzen State Pedagogical University of Russia | 1001 | – | – |
Financial University under the Government of the Russian Federation | 1001 | – | – |
Moscow Power Engineering Institute | 1201 | 1201 | – |
Moscow Technological University | 1201 | 1201 | – |
Irkutsk State University | 1201 | 1201 | – |
Don State Technical University | 1201 | 501 | – |
Russian State University for the Humanities | 1201 | – | – |
Russian State Agrarian University - Moscow Timiryazev Agricultural Academy | 1201 | – | – |
Moscow Pedagogical State University | 1201 | – | – |
Moscow City University | 1201 | – | – |
Yuri Gagarin State Technical University of Saratov (SSTU) | – | 1201 | – |
Southwest State University | – | 1201 | – |
Privolzhsky Research Medical University | – | 1201 | – |
Pavlov First Saint Petersburg State Medical University | – | 1201 | – |
Nosov Magnitogorsk State Technical University | – | 1201 | – |
Nizhny Novgorod State Technical University | – | 1201 | – |
Moscow Polytechnic University | – | 1201 | – |
Ivanovo State University of Chemistry and Technology | – | 1201 | – |
Tomsk State University of Control Systems and Radioelectronics | – | 1201 | – |
Samara State Technical University | – | 1201 | – |
Pirogov Russian National Research Medical University | – | 1201 | – |
Perm National Research Polytechnic University | – | 1201 | – |
Omsk State Technical University | – | 1201 | – |
North-Eastern Federal University | – | 1201 | – |
National Research University of Electronic Technology (MIET) | – | 1201 | – |
Moscow Aviation Institute | – | 1201 | – |
Kazan National Research Technical University | – | 1201 | – |
Gubkin Russian State University of Oil and Gas | – | 1201 | – |
Bashkir State University | – | 1201 | – |
Moscow State University of Civil Engineering | – | 601 | – |
Volgograd State Technical University | – | 1001 | – |
Skolkovo Institute of Science and Technology | – | – | 701 |
The QS World University Rankings are among the most important, most-referenced rankings. The QS ranking relies heavily on its academic survey, asking thousands of academics worldwide about the reputation of universities.
The Times Higher Education World University Rankings (or the THE Rankings for short) compile a wide range of statistics. Equal weight is put on teaching quality, research excellence, and research impact through citations (meaning how often a university’s research is referenced elsewhere).
The Academic Ranking of World Universities by Shanghai Jiao Tong University (often just Shanghai Ranking, or ARWU) focuses on research output and quality, for example measured by the number of published and cited scientific papers and the number of staff or alumni winning the Nobel Prize or Fields Medal.
